iris ding updated CXF-5943: --------------------------- Attachment: cxf-5943.patch > Throw error in exceptionmapper > ------------------------------ > > Key: CXF-5943 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CXF-5943 > Project: CXF > Issue Type: Bug > Components: JAX-RS > Affects Versions: 3.0.0 > Reporter: iris ding > Attachments: cxf-5943.patch > > > In ExceptionUtils.convertFaultToResponse(), it only catches Exception. So > CXF fails to process the request if we throw Error in our own > XXXExceptionMapper. The definition of ExceptionMapper is: > Interface ExceptionMapper<E extends Throwable> So I think we should catch > Throwable instead. > if (response == null) { > ExceptionMapper<T> mapper = > > ServerProviderFactory.getInstance(inMessage).createExceptionMapper(ex.getClass(), > inMessage); > if (mapper != null) { > try { > response = mapper.toResponse(ex); > } catch (Exception mapperEx) { > > inMessage.getExchange().put(JAXRSUtils.EXCEPTION_FROM_MAPPER, "true"); > mapperEx.printStackTrace(); > return Response.serverError().build(); > } > } > } > } -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.2#6252)
